Top-Themen

AppleEntwicklungHardwareInternetLinuxMicrosoftMultimediaNetzwerkeOff TopicSicherheitSonstige SystemeVirtualisierungWeiterbildungZusammenarbeit

Aktuelle Themen (A bis Z)

Administrator.de FeedbackApache ServerAppleAssemblerAudioAusbildungAuslandBackupBasicBatch & ShellBenchmarksBibliotheken & ToolkitsBlogsCloud-DiensteClusterCMSCPU, RAM, MainboardsCSSC und C++DatenbankenDatenschutzDebianDigitiales FernsehenDNSDrucker und ScannerDSL, VDSLE-BooksE-BusinessE-MailEntwicklungErkennung und -AbwehrExchange ServerFestplatten, SSD, RaidFirewallFlatratesGoogle AndroidGrafikGrafikkarten & MonitoreGroupwareHardwareHosting & HousingHTMLHumor (lol)Hyper-VIconsIDE & EditorenInformationsdiensteInstallationInstant MessagingInternetInternet DomäneniOSISDN & AnaloganschlüsseiTunesJavaJavaScriptKiXtartKVMLAN, WAN, WirelessLinuxLinux DesktopLinux NetzwerkLinux ToolsLinux UserverwaltungLizenzierungMac OS XMicrosoftMicrosoft OfficeMikroTik RouterOSMonitoringMultimediaMultimedia & ZubehörNetzwerkeNetzwerkgrundlagenNetzwerkmanagementNetzwerkprotokolleNotebook & ZubehörNovell NetwareOff TopicOpenOffice, LibreOfficeOutlook & MailPapierkorbPascal und DelphiPeripheriegerätePerlPHPPythonRechtliche FragenRedHat, CentOS, FedoraRouter & RoutingSambaSAN, NAS, DASSchriftartenSchulung & TrainingSEOServerServer-HardwareSicherheitSicherheits-ToolsSicherheitsgrundlagenSolarisSonstige SystemeSoziale NetzwerkeSpeicherkartenStudentenjobs & PraktikumSuche ProjektpartnerSuseSwitche und HubsTipps & TricksTK-Netze & GeräteUbuntuUMTS, EDGE & GPRSUtilitiesVB for ApplicationsVerschlüsselung & ZertifikateVideo & StreamingViren und TrojanerVirtualisierungVisual StudioVmwareVoice over IPWebbrowserWebentwicklungWeiterbildungWindows 7Windows 8Windows 10Windows InstallationWindows MobileWindows NetzwerkWindows ServerWindows SystemdateienWindows ToolsWindows UpdateWindows UserverwaltungWindows VistaWindows XPXenserverXMLZusammenarbeit
GELÖST

Spannung auf Pins der COM-Schnittstelle legen

Frage Entwicklung C und C++

Mitglied: BernddasBrot2

BernddasBrot2 (Level 1) - Jetzt verbinden

04.03.2010, aktualisiert 16:00 Uhr, 3503 Aufrufe, 2 Kommentare

Hallo zusammen,

ich möchte mir ein Programm schreiben, das bei mir bestimmte Relais steuern soll. Dazu wollte ich einfach jedes Relais an einen bestimmten Pin der COM-Schnittstelle anschließen.
Wenn ich im Internet nach Tutorials suche Ports zu programmieren, finde ich nur schwer verständliche Codeschnipsel, die am Ende ganze Bytes übertragen wollen.

Gibt's da auch ne einfache Möglichkeit auf einzelne Pins Spannung zu legen, un wieder zu nehmen?

Mein Betriebssystem ist Win7, könnte das ganze aber auch auf Linux versuchen.

Danke schon mal
Bernd
Mitglied: Arano
04.03.2010 um 16:13 Uhr
Hallo Bernd,

ich hatte mal was ähnliches aber viel kleiner: Setzen und lesen von Pins des LPT-Ports.
Müsste doch eigentlich auch auf den COM-Port anwendbar sein !?
Schau doch mal hier ob es dir weiterhilft: LPT mit C Programm ansteuern


~Arano

Edit:
Okay, wenn ich mrtux Beitrag (s.u.) so lese scheint es mir das ich mich wohl geirrt habe
Bitte warten ..
Mitglied: mrtux
04.03.2010 um 16:15 Uhr
Hi !

Um die Software würde ich mich erst mal gar nicht kümmern, denn ohne die nötigen Kenntnisse in der Elektronik....

Aus der seriellen Schnittstelle kommt kein TTL-Pegel, darum kannst Du da schon mal kein Relais (ohne Pegelwandler, Auswertung und Vorstufe) anschliessen. Ausserdem kannst Du gleich mal vergessen, ein Relais direkt an eine PC-Schnittstelle anschliessen zu wollen, ohne weitere Elektronik geht da gar nix bzw. danach nix mehr.. :-P

Da musst Du erst mal eine kleine Schaltung bauen, um ein Relais anschliessen/ansteuern zu können oder kauf dir besser einen Bausatz (im Elektronikhandel gibts die schon ab 9,99 Euro), da liegt meist schon eine Software zur Steuerung bei. Bessere Bausätze bieten auch ein SDK für gängige Entwicklungswerkzeuge z.B. für C, Java oder Delphi (Pascal). Diese Bausätze werden aber eher an der parallelen Schnittstelle angeschlossen, da dort der elektronische Aufwand geringer ist. Ich meine ich hätte gelesen, dass es mittlerweile solche Relais-Schaltungsboards auch für USB gibt....

mrtux
Bitte warten ..
Ähnliche Inhalte
Windows 10
gelöst Pin anmeldung unter w10 priorisieren (3)

Frage von tobias3355 zum Thema Windows 10 ...

Windows Server
RFID SmartCard Anmeldung ohne PIN (9)

Frage von podogu zum Thema Windows Server ...

Windows Netzwerk
PIN-Abfrage nach Azure Domain-Join (3)

Frage von PatrickKipp84 zum Thema Windows Netzwerk ...

Windows Server
Smartcard Anmeldung ohne PIN (7)

Frage von manuelw zum Thema Windows Server ...

Neue Wissensbeiträge
Windows Update

Novemberpatches und Nadeldrucker bereiten Kopfschmerzen

(14)

Tipp von MettGurke zum Thema Windows Update ...

Windows 10

Abhilfe für Abstürze von CDPUsersvc auf Win10 1607 und 2016 1607

(7)

Tipp von DerWoWusste zum Thema Windows 10 ...

RedHat, CentOS, Fedora

Fedora 27 ist verfügbar

Information von Frank zum Thema RedHat, CentOS, Fedora ...

Heiß diskutierte Inhalte
Windows Server
Kennwort vergessen bei Hyper vserver 2012r (12)

Frage von jensgebken zum Thema Windows Server ...

Linux Desktop
Bildschirmauflösung unter Linux festlegen (12)

Frage von itebob zum Thema Linux Desktop ...

Windows Userverwaltung
gelöst Administrator hat alle Rechte verloren (10)

Frage von mrdead zum Thema Windows Userverwaltung ...

LAN, WAN, Wireless
Gebäude mit WLAN ausstatten (9)

Frage von udobec zum Thema LAN, WAN, Wireless ...